So why will they be the people you retain reaching out to on internet dating sites?

That is a typical trend individuals fall into, relating to
study
from Queensland College of Technology. Despite having very clear standards—or at the very least a sense of a “type” that they are looking for—dating website consumers typically get in touch with people who have next to absolutely nothing in common with regards to perfect.

And listed here is the thing: that is not necessarily poor.

Within the research, appropriately known as “Preference vs possibility in online dating sites,” researchers analyzed the tastes and habits of about 41,000 Australians between the years 18-80 who were utilizing the online dating sites web site RSVP. In most, experts sifted through above 219,000 associates produced by the consumers in a four-month span.

The results showed that people casted a greater net than even they would anticipated. “How people go about locating someone is changing significantly due to the net,” examine co-author Stephen Whyte stated in a
pr release
. “Where even as we were limited to settings eg college, work, social gatherings, or neighborhood night places, there is a much bigger choice at hand on the internet.”

That is certainly not really a poor thing. Actually, the investigation, printed in the journal

Cyberpsychology, Behaviour and Social Networking

, suggests online dating sites will connect more and more people than in the past.

“the learn evaluated the relationships of men and women whose many years varied from millennials to octogenarians, which in itself shows just how extensive internet dating is as well as how truly altering standard ways people select potential love passions,” Whyte mentioned.
